电脑孵化机多变量模糊专家控制

摘    要:基于现代家禽孵化工艺要求,将复杂的多变量耦合孵化过程控制系统分解成风门控制子系统、加热控制子系统和加湿控制子系统,提出一种多变量模糊专家控制器及其解耦设计方法,成功地应用于家禽孵化设备,实现了孵化机模糊专家计算机控制系统,提高了孵化机的控制性能和自动化水平,从而提高了孵化率,减少了弱雏数量,并减轻了工人的劳动强度。

MULTIVARIABLE FUZZY EXPERT CONTROLLERFOR POULTRY INCUBATOR

Abstract:In this paper, a multivariable coupling control system of the incubation process was divided into three subsystems according to modern technological requirements of the poultry incubation. These subsystems are heating subsystem, dampening subsystem and operating air door subsystem. The MIMO fuzzy controller of the incubation process was decomposed into two SISO subsystems and a MISO subsystem. A new multivariable fuzzy expert controller and its fuzzy decoupling design method were proposed. It was successfully applied into the poultry incubation process control. The performance characteristics and function of the incubator were modified. Hence, hatchability was greatly increased and the number of young poultry in delicate health was greatly decreased.
